I have a few clients come in needing me to "finish" the job. If you are THAT insistent on doing it yourself, here are some tips:<br />-apply in thin layers. the goopier the wax, the more will be left behind.<br />- i always use strip wax for the top and hard wax (stripless wax) for the lower region. it's MUCH gentler and less painful.<br />-use only oil to remove the wax...NO rubbing alcohol.<br />-hold the skin TIGHT. loose skin=skin being removed along with the hair.<br />-where you bruised is a VERY common spot because of how thin the skin is along the tendon. seperate the leg into two sections. 1 being below the tendon (usually the hair grows up) and 2 being above the tendon where your underwear line is. DO NOT wax over the tendon.<br /><br />Honestly I would just get a professional to do it...you may be out 60 bucks but its a lot less painful and only 30 minutes of torture...<br />:) happy waxing!genevievehttp://www.shipswithnosails.comnore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-3759684823522679114.post-43011201277914304742010-06-16T16:36:58.798-07:002010-06-16T16:36:58.798-07:00CC here (I'm just too lazy to switch google ac...CC here (I'm just too lazy to switch google accounts):<br /><br />I'd probably fuck it up more if I boozed it up beforehand.
